I've worked in environmental roles at the Texas Department of Transportation for over 15 years. What started as a part-time, college job to assist with drafting turned into a long-term career with many twists and turns. I was a general environmental project manager, then specialized in social and economic analyses. I developed expertise in analyzing how transportation projects influence land use and development, how their impacts spread out in time and distance, and how they contribute to the overall status of the resources they affect (indirect and cumulative impacts, in NEPA-speak). I analyzed legislative proposals and new regulatory requirements and found ways to implement them. I participated in research projects and got involved in national research initiatives. Eventually, I focused on overall environmental policy and process improvement. I developed concepts, led teams, and managed projects to incorporate new requirements, identify opportunities for improvements, and develop and implement initiatives intended to make the environmental process more efficient and effective. Now, I've returned to my previous areas of expertise with the intent of bringing my experience in improvement and innovation to projects affecting our communities.

Key accomplishments include: I researched existing literature and adapted existing approaches to establish a process for analyzing indirect impacts of transportation projects, emphasizing impacts relating to land use and development. National guidance and that used in other states did not account for differences in typical highway design or the variability in land use practices in Texas. I developed guidance for highly complex analyses and obtained buy-in from stakeholders. I also provided technical assistance and feedback on analyses produced using the guidance. I assumed responsibility for managing an $800,000 contract in progress. I identified that the work to date was off-target. Although approximately two-thirds of the time and budget were spent, work was only 40% complete and had limited utility. I corrected the incorrect invoicing practices, revised existing work authorizations and issued new ones to guide the consultants to provide better results. The project was completed with minimal change in budget, no change in a critical timeline, and the final products met agency needs and external requirements.
